The U.S. Army announced a consolidation of 120 separate contracts with Anduril Industries into one enterprise agreement with a potential $20 billion ceiling over ten years. The agreement centers on Anduril's Lattice operating system, an open software platform designed to integrate data from distributed sensors and multiple sources into a unified layer. This enterprise contract includes software platforms, integrated hardware, data infrastructure, and support services. The Army structured the agreement with a five-year base period and optional five-year extension to establish pre-negotiated pricing, leverage volume discounts, and enable flexible purchasing. This consolidation mirrors the Army's similar $10 billion agreement with Palantir announced in August, reflecting the military's modernization strategy to streamline software acquisition, eliminate redundancies, and accelerate deployment of critical capabilities.
